Semi Truck Accident Compensation

You may be eligible for compensation if you or someone close to you has been injured in an accident involving semi. The amount you can claim depends on your injuries and other losses, including medical bills or lost wages, suffering and pain.

This article will explain how these damages are calculated as well as the factors that are considered when negotiating your settlement.

Damages

The damage that semi-truck accidents is often much more severe than in cases with smaller vehicles. These trucks are massive and heavy, and they can cause severe damage if they collide with other vehicles or cars. In addition to the physical damage and medical expenses that result from these accidents, victims also suffer an income loss as they take time off work to recover from their injuries. Fortunately, those losses are recoverable in an accident lawsuit against a truck.

In the event of a truck crash the kinds of damages claimed are divided into economic and non-economic. Economic damages are those that can be documented using receipts or other evidence. They include expenses such as the cost of hospitalization, medications, and the cost of repairing or replacing a vehicle. The law of the state can limit the damages to a certain amount.

Medical bills

The injuries caused by semi-truck accidents can be serious and result in victims facing huge medical bills. These bills are often higher than the minimum coverage required by federal and state laws. These types of injuries include traumatizing brain injuries and spinal cord injuries. They can also cause loss of limbs. The victims will also need to cover medical expenses for the rest of their lives. The pain and suffering damages are also accounted for in the amount of compensation to which they are entitled to.

Semi truck accident victims could be forced to miss work as a result of their injuries. This could lead to lower wages. If the injuries they sustain are permanent and permanent, they could be permanently out of work. This means that they could no longer earn a living and Vimeo will have to depend on financial aid from friends or family members or on government assistance. If the injury victim was a spouse or parent who was the primary caregiver for the household losing income could have devastating consequences for their families.

A successful claim for medical expenses will also be able to cover future medical expenses and any rehabilitation services the victim of an accident may require. These treatments can be costly particularly if physical or occupational therapy is involved. In some cases the trucking company may delay or deny the claim. Lost wages

Commercial truck accidents can be deadly and catastrophic. It is incredibly uncommon for anyone to leave an accident with an uninjured semi truck. People who survive are often forced to deal with huge medical bills and loss of income. This is especially true if the accident happened in the period of Christmas which is when trucking companies are rushing to finish deliveries on time.

The victims can also seek compensation for the loss of income. This includes the amount they could have earned if they hadn't be forced to work because of injuries. It also considers any loss in future earnings potential if the injuries have permanently changed the type of work that the person is able to do or reduced their working hours.

To prove the loss of wages an attorney might require the wage verification statement of your employer as along with past pay stubs as well as tax returns. You may also be able to use your own documents, such as bank statement and invoices from services rendered prior to the accident to prove your earnings. A doctor's report that outlines the number of days or weeks you were absent at work is another important piece of evidence. This document can also be used to determine if your absences are due to sickness or work leave.

Suffering and pain

A semi truck crash is terrifying due to the vast size and weight difference between these cars and a passenger car. In addition to the obvious physical damage caused by these collisions victims are also likely to suffer hefty medical expenses and miss time at work. When this occurs, injured victims deserve to be compensated for the damages they incur.

Victims of a semi truck crash can seek two types of damages that are non-economic and economic. Economic damages aim to cover the cost of a victim's personal expenses which include medical treatment and vehicle repair costs. Non-economic damages are subjective and can cover a broad spectrum of costs that impact the quality of life of the victim. One of the most commonly used types of non-economic damages is pain and suffering.

The amount of pain that an individual victim could experience as part of their settlement will depend on the severity of their injuries and how they have affected their lives. For instance a person who sustained injuries to the head during an accident involving trucks will suffer more long-lasting effects than a person who suffered a broken leg. A person who suffers the most severe injury is entitled to be compensated more to cover their pain and damages.

Furthermore, an individual who was forced to miss a significant amount of work because of an injury could be entitled to compensation for lost wages. This includes the hours they missed while recovering and the amount of time they could be working if they had not suffered an injury. If an individual is unable to return to their work they may also be able to claim lost future earnings.
